breaking the silence
the broken bridge weathered
timber cracked how is it I hear
your father's boat slicing
the water deep in
the bitterroot
slope

perhaps it
is just a creak
in the tired
birch
or

perhaps
the hours have passed and
nodding eyes cannot wait with such
bracelets of sorrow yet I over slept the
mourn hoping to find you in my dream
so often a kind of kaleidoscopic beauty
has such infinite variety disclosed to
the slumbering eyes in a slowly
evolving movement in the
early dawn when
every sound
appears
audible
even to the
soft spilling breeze
where the creek lies with
the snow grasping limbs
of laden bridge
